Remove the USB device
To remove a USB device, proceed as follows:
To call the file manager, press the
PGM MGT key
Select the left window with the arrow key
Use the arrow keys to select the USB device to be
removed
Scroll through the soft-key row
Select additional functions
Scroll through the soft-key row
Select the function for removing USB devices. The
TNC removes the USB device from the directory
tree and reports
The USB device can be removed
now.
Remove the USB device
Quit the File Manager
In order to re-establish a connection with a USB device that has
been removed, press the following soft key:
Select the function for reconnection of USB
devices
